Choreography and Stunt Design in Bloody Girl Fight Scenes

Choreographers prioritize safety while ensuring the illusion of danger remains intact. Precision in timing, spacing, and weapon handling allows performers to execute complex sequences without compromising physical integrity.

Camera work, lighting, and sound design intensify each impact, turning practical effects into memorable cinematic moments. Close-up angles, slow-motion inserts, and directional audio highlight the emotional gravity of each strike.

Physical Preparation and Rehearsal

Actors undergo intensive training in martial arts, weapon handling, and stunt falling to build confidence and consistency. Repeated run-throughs with padding and controlled resistance help performers nail spacing and breath control.

Practical Effects and Blood Simulants

Squibs, air blasts, and silicone-based blood packs create realistic bursts and streaming effects that react convincingly to movement. Color grading and post-production touch-ups refine the contrast of costumes, skin, and environmental blood tones.

Character Motivation and Narrative Stakes

A bloody girl fight often emerges from deeply personal motives, such as protecting a loved one or reclaiming agency after trauma. Writers use these sequences to externalize internal conflict, turning emotional tension into visible action.

The context leading to the confrontation shapes audience perception of the character’s choices, making the violence feel justified, tragic, or redemptive. Clear objectives, escalating pressure, and moral dilemmas ensure the scene advances the broader story rather than relying on shock value alone.

Emotional Transformation Through Combat

Physical struggle becomes a visual metaphor for psychological change, as scars and blood symbolize the cost of survival. Viewers connect with characters who evolve from hesitation to decisive action, especially when the fight reflects hard-won self-identity.
